WS11 0DG is a mixed residential and non-residential postcode in Bridgtown, Cannock. It was first introduced in March 2003.
The most common council tax band is A.
Residential buildings are typically semi-detached and terraced (including end-terrace). Domestic properties are mostly houses and flats.
Estimated residential property values, based on historical transactions and adjusted for inflation, range from £84,320 to £183,017 with an average of £130,915.
Residential buildings were typically constructed between 1900 and 1929 and before 1900.
None of the residential properties sold since 1995 have been new builds or newly converted.
Domestic properties are mostly owner occupied, with some privately rented
The most common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ating is E.
Commercial rateable values range from £1,875 to £21,000 with an average of £7,145. The most common recorded business types are Warehouse and Workshop.
Cannock is a town, which had a population of 67,768 in the 2011 census.
In the 2011 census, there were 28 people resident in WS11 0DG, of which 14 were male and 14 were female. This also includes overnight visitors at domestic properties, and residents of non-domestic properties such as hotels, prisons and halls of residence.
WS11 0DG is in the Wolverhampton and Walsall travel to work area. NHS services are provided by the South Staffordshire Primary Care Trust.
WS11 0DG is approximately 123m (404ft) above sea level.
